Output 3aeb47cc34165a3095bed8255bd4dd60f9eac97727ef6efc1fd4977123bb3112:0

value
1587856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cb2d9c4f83fb25fadaf9b8f665fff47b67ee3d OP_EQUAL
address
39soTgaNAXKo4JzobrfizHJhrKnpdSqX3o
transaction
3aeb47cc34165a3095bed8255bd4dd60f9eac97727ef6efc1fd4977123bb3112
spent
true